What Bonsall fence projects actually look like

Bonsall fence work is rural inland scope on multi-acre parcels between Vista and Fallbrook. Home values typically run $900K-$3.5M+ across parcels that average two to ten acres or more. Significant equestrian inventory (the Bonsall area has long been associated with horse properties, with the San Luis Rey River corridor running through the community providing both irrigation and equestrian trail access), plus working avocado groves and the broader agricultural land use, drives the scope mix.

Most of Bonsall sits within the CalFire wildland-urban-interface (WUI) zone with defensible-space rules applying within five feet of structures. Summer heat runs 90-100°F routinely from June through September, significantly hotter than coastal Carlsbad or Encinitas but milder than the more inland Valley Center or Escondido. Pine pickets fail within two summers in Bonsall; cedar and Class-A vinyl are the durable wood and synthetic options, with galvanized chain link as the cost-effective answer for long-perimeter property definition and agricultural perimeter.

Bonsall scope detail

Working specs for Bonsall fence projects

A typical Bonsall residential project on the smaller half-acre to two-acre parcels is replacement or new construction at 200-400 linear feet of perimeter, with the working scope being three-rail wood for visual frontage, vinyl or wood privacy at the rear yard, and the WUI buffer transition to non-combustible material within five feet of the house. Equestrian and ranchette work on the larger Old River Road, West Lilac Road, and Camino Del Rey-area parcels runs different scope entirely.

Equestrian and ranchette work typically runs 1,000-3,500 linear feet of perimeter on two-to-ten-acre parcels. Standard spec is pressure-treated 4x6 posts set 36-42 inches deep in concrete, three rails of rough-cut cedar or redwood, 2x4 welded-wire no-climb mesh on the inside face, pipe corral around stables and round pens, and 14-16 foot drive gates with solar-powered or hardwired automatic operators. Avocado grove perimeter is typically galvanized chain link with top rail in 6-8 foot height. The crews we send coordinate scheduling around horse turnout, harvest cycles for working agricultural operations, and any equipment access for grove maintenance. How much does a new fence cost in Bonsall?

A typical 150-foot backyard fence installed in Bonsall runs $4,200–$6,500 for chain link, $6,800–$11,500 for cedar privacy, and $8,500–$14,000 for Class-A vinyl privacy. Pool-barrier installs start around $3,400 for removable mesh and $6,800 for ornamental aluminum. Gate installation adds $300–$650 per walk gate; drive gates with automatic openers $2,400–$7,500.

Most Bonsall fence companies quote free. Three things worth checking on any bid. Verify the license number yourself at the California CSLB site, cslb.ca.gov, since a real one is public and takes thirty seconds to confirm. Get the quote broken into materials, labor, gates, and permits, because a single lump sum makes two bids impossible to compare. And ask what happens to the old fence, as haul-away is the line most often left out and added later.

Do WUI fire-zone rules apply to my Bonsall fence?

Yes for most Bonsall properties. The community sits within the CalFire wildland-urban-interface (WUI) zone with defensible-space rules applying within five feet of any structure. Combustible materials including standard wood fence are restricted in the zone-zero buffer. The pro designs the rear-perimeter with non-combustible material (galvanized chain link, steel-tube ornamental aluminum, or non-combustible vinyl with steel-core posts) for the five feet closest to the house, then standard vinyl or wood for the main rear-yard run. The transition gets documented for CalFire and insurance compliance.

Do you build equestrian fence on Bonsall horse properties?

Yes. Equestrian operations on the larger Old River Road, West Lilac Road, and Camino Del Rey-area parcels are one of the most frequent scopes in this area. A typical project runs 1,000-3,500 linear feet of perimeter on a two-to-ten-acre parcel, with pressure-treated 4x6 posts set 36-42 inches deep in concrete, three rails of rough-cut cedar or redwood, and 2x4 welded-wire no-climb mesh on the inside face. Drive gates run 14-16 feet with commercial-grade hinges and optional automatic operators. Local crews here integrate stable, barn, and round-pen access with the larger fence layout and coordinate scheduling around horse turnout.

Can you do avocado grove perimeter fence in Bonsall?

Yes. Agricultural perimeter for working avocado groves and the broader nursery industry is a regular Bonsall scope. Standard answer is galvanized chain link with top rail in 6-8 foot height, sometimes with three-strand barbed-wire top extension on remote-perimeter sections. The working spec is 11-gauge mesh for general perimeter, 9-gauge for higher-security or wildlife-exclusion applications. Project schedule coordinates around harvest cycles and equipment access. Drive gates are sized for the equipment that needs to enter the property.

How long does cedar fence last in Bonsall?

Properly built cedar privacy fence in Bonsall gives 18-25 year real-world service life with stain or oil maintenance on a three-to-five-year cycle. Pine fails within two Bonsall summers and is never the right choice here. The variables that drive longevity are post installation (concrete footings 36-42 inches deep with the plug crowned above grade), hardware quality (hot-dip galvanized fasteners at minimum), and maintenance discipline on the stain or oil cycle.

How much does it cost for 1,500 feet of ranch perimeter in Bonsall?

For a typical 1,500-linear-foot Bonsall ranch perimeter (three-rail rough-cut cedar with 2x4 welded-wire no-climb mesh, corner bracing, two-to-three gates including one 14-16 foot drive gate, hardware throughout), total project cost runs $50,000-$78,000 depending on terrain, gate operator scope, and any pipe corral or specialized agricultural perimeter add-ons. The work typically runs three to six weeks of on-site time. The crews we work with stage the work so no pasture is fully open overnight.
